From 8548481fa152f146e7213cddca5e3b400999c150 Mon Sep 17 00:00:00 2001 From: stuebinm Date: Mon, 13 Dec 2021 23:58:06 +0100 Subject: refuse doubled map properties --- lib/Properties.hs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'lib') diff --git a/lib/Properties.hs b/lib/Properties.hs index c106b9f..bb18499 100644 --- a/lib/Properties.hs +++ b/lib/Properties.hs @@ -58,6 +58,7 @@ checkMap = do -- not specific to any one of them refuseDoubledNames (tiledmapLayers tiledmap) refuseDoubledNames (tiledmapTilesets tiledmap) + refuseDoubledNames (getProperties tiledmap) -- some layers should exist unlessElementNamed (tiledmapLayers tiledmap) "start" @@ -161,7 +162,7 @@ checkLayer :: LintWriter Layer checkLayer = do layer <- askContext - refuseDoubledNames (getProperties layer) + refuseDoubledNames (getProperties layer) when (isJust (layerImage layer)) $ complain "imagelayer are not supported." -- cgit v1.2.3